Ever seen this painting? It’s the most famous painting in Wales, many Welsh homes will have a copy on their wall. But did you know the original isn’t in Wales?
I’m currently playing Sydney Curnow Vosper, the painter of this painting, in a brand new play by Lisa Parry (A playwright that originally learnt Welsh with the SSiW method) developed in partnership with Sherman Theatre.
I’m not usually one for self promotion, but since it’s a Welsh story, I thought it might be of interest. There’s minimal Welsh language, so you don’t need to know Welsh to watch it.
Show Description:
Capel Salem, Gwynedd. In 2025, two Welsh students hide out with ‘Salem’ – a painting they’ve stolen from a Liverpool art gallery to decolonise Welsh art. In 1908, Sydney Curnow Vosper paints, his vision disputed by its sitters. Is it possible to ever prescribe a work of art’s meaning?
